Веб-разработчик. Опыт работы во фронтенд-разработке более 4 лет, опыт разработки веб-приложений полного цикла: проектирование архитектуры, фронтенд и бэкенд разработка, автоматизированное тестирование и поддержка. Начинал с css, html около 4 лет назад. Затем начал интересоваться Vanilla JavaScript и его возможностями. Сейчас больший фокус на веб-разработке с упором на фронтенд. Использование ReactJS и Angular в качестве основных фреймворков/библиотек во фронтенде, в бэкенде — NodeJS. Стремление к изучению новых технологий, обучению на практике и выполнению разнообразных задач. Опыт работы в команде и хорошие коммуникативные навыки. Основные навыки: JavaScript, TypeScript, React, Angular, NodeJS, ExpressJS.
Трудолюбивый и ответственный Frontend-разработчик. Решает задачи и проблемы, не смотря на любые возникающие трудности. Постоянно развивается, изучает современные технологий, быстро обучаема. Командный игрок, легко адаптируется к изменениям, как в рабочих процессах, так и в коллективе. Присутствует огромное желание развиваться в сфере финансовых технологий.
Разработчик, заинтересованный в создании уникальных решений для решения нестандартных задач. Обладаю большой тягой к стримлайну и оптимизации рабочих процессов и самосовершенствованию во всех областях жизни. Pre S.: при чтении CV необходимо учитывать, что INFINITE SYNERGY занимается разработкой ПО на заказ, по большей части это именно аутсорсинг, а не аутстаффинг. Данный специалист работал на нескольких проектах за все 3 года ввиду специфики данного направления в нашей компании.
Senior Frontend-разработчик с большим опытом.
Опыт в качестве Frontend-разработчика – 5,5 лет. Последний проект в сфере финтех – разработка сервиса на базе микрофронтендов для внутренних сотрудников одного крупного банка. Занимался версткой экранов с 0, доработкой существующего функционала, улучшением инфраструктуры (внедрение линтеров, гит.хуков и.т.д). Создавал сложные UI-элементы с микрофронтами: экран формирования команд, экран компетенций, экран списка задач.
Профессиональные навыки: • Java Core • Framework Spring (Spring MVC, Spring boot, Spring Data Jpa, Spring Security, Spring HATEOAS, Spring Java Mail Sender и тд) • Микросервисная архитектура • Безопасность web приложений в том числе микросервисных (OpenID, oAuth2, JWT, Keycloak) • Базы данных (Реляционные(MySQL, PostgreSQL), не реляционные (Redis)) • Брокеры сообщений Kafka/RabbitMQ • JUnit 5, Mockito, TestContainers • Swagger / OpenAPI • Шаблонизаторы (JSP, Freemarker) • REST API • Git, Maven, Gradle • Docker • Kubernetes • Gitlab CI/CD • Elasticsearch, ELK stack. Командная разработка. Большая самостоятельность при решении задач. Опыт использование инструментов DevOps.
Контейнеризация приложений и запуск на ECS (EC2 и Fargate). Настройка ArgoCD для реализации GitOps подходит и автоматизирует развертывание приложений в Kubernetes. Запуск контейнерного приложения в kubernetes (с использованием карты конфигурации, секретов, входа, служб, развертываний); Управление инфраструктурой с помощью Terraform. Проектирование и внедрение систем мониторинга на основе Prometheus. Использование языков программирования: Bash, PowerShell. Создание и обслуживание полностью автоматизированных конвейеров CI/CD.
Professional skills Programming languages: С#, SQL. Technologies\Libraries: RS-232, ADO, XML NET, Interop, XAML, WCF, WPF, LINQ2SQL, WPFToolkit, ActiPro WPF Studio, DevExpress WPF controls UML, Desing patterns, Refactoring. Software: MS Visual Studio + TFS, MS SQL Server, Subversion, CodeSmith Experienced in managing a small team. Experienced in Agile development (Kanban/SCRUM). Experienced in foreign code support
Ключевые навыки: - Опыт работы в JIRA; - Опыт работы по Agile (Scrum и Canban) - SQL (составление базовых запросов); - Знание теории тестирования; - Анализ требований к разрабатываемому ПО; - Опыт составления чек-листов, тест-кейсов, заведение баг-репортов; - Техники тест-дизайна (классы эквивалентности, граничные значения); - ручное функциональное, интеграционное, регрессионное, тестирование REST API с помощью Postman (GET, POST, PUT, DELETE); - работа с MySQL, PostgreSQL (JOIN по нескольким таблицам; INSERT, UPDATE, DELETE; подзапросы, сортировка); - локализация, регистрация дефектов; - Понимание клиент серверной архитектуры; Используемые программы: Jira, Azure, Confluence, Devtools, Postman, Figma